Abstract
The effect of exercise on the elevation of HSP70 was studied in rats fed a different diet on the B_6 content (as pyridoxine 1.5 mg/kg diet or 7.5 mg/kg diet). Minimum requirement of B_6 in the diet is known to be about 1.5 mg/kg diet in 20 % casein diet. Rats were divided into 4 groups in each series and assigned as Sc (sedentary control), Se (sedentary-exhaustion), Ec (training control), and Ee (trainingexhaustion). HSP70 was determined in the heart, liver and gastrocnemius muscle (red and white portions). HSP70 in the heart was not changed in all groups of both series. In the liver HSP70 was elevated to very high levels in Sc and Ee groups in the rats fed the high level of B_6, and where as a little in Ee group in rats fed low level of B_6. The levels of inductions were in the muscle not so high very similar but as observed in the liver. AST (aspartate aminotransferase) activity was significantly elevated in Ec and Ee for the liver, and in the three groups for the kidney and muscle (red portion) in the rats fed the high level of B_6. On the contrary in all tissues in all groups fed low level of B_6, AST activity was not changed at all. Thus the low induction of HSP70 in the tissues, especially in the liver of rats fed the low B_6 diet, may suggest impairment of amino acid metabolism and, consequently, insufficiency of energy supply.
